Louis IV d'Outre-Mer, King of the West Franks 1 2

  • Born: 10 Sep 920, <Laon, (Aisne), Picardy>, France
  • Marriage (1): Gerberga of Saxony 939 or 940
  • Died: 10 Sep 954, Reims, (Marne), Champagne, France at age 34
  • Buried: Abbaye de St. Rémy, Reims, (Marne), Champagne, (France)

   Another name for Louis was Louis IV "Transmarinus" King of Western Francia.

  Research Notes:

King of the West Franks 936-954

Source: Ancestral Roots of Certain American Colonists Who Came to America before 1700 by Frederick Lewis Weis and Walter Lee Sheppard, Jr, ed. by William R. Beall & Kaleen E. Beall (Baltimore, 2008), line 148-18


Louis married Gerberga of Saxony, daughter of Henry I "the Fowler" Duke of Saxony, King of the Saxons and Mechtilde of Ringelheim, 939 or 940. (Gerberga of Saxony was born about 914 in <Nordhausen, Saxony, (Thuringia, Germany)>, died on 5 May 984 in Reims, (Marne), Champagne, France and was buried in Reims, (Marne), Champagne, France.)
